From I.E. Wallen "The Hames Chronicles" pg. 82
Hiram is described as the family patriarch of a long line of Montgomerys.  THe farm where they lived was settled about 1770.  Hiram inherited an equal share of his mother-in-law's estate in 1852 as did his brother, Samuel.  In the 1850 Census Hiram lived in Murray County with $8,000 in real estate.  In the 1860 Census report he is listed as having $16,000 in real estate plus $5,292 in personal property.
In 1848 there was a Montgomery Post Office; Montgomery School opened in 1890.  The Montgomery Ferry operated until 1917 when Montgomery Bridge was built.  The high point was called Montgomerys (later McEntires after the two families intermarried).  Montgomery Road with Montgomery Bridge was built from Ball Ground to Wells, GA.  In 1860 the home was in redistricted into Lumpkin County, Yfahoola District at the Census.  The home later became McEntires Farm.  Hiram's mother was believed to be Ailsey Montgomery who is believed to have lieved with them when she died.  Hiram died on 10 Dec 1867 and was buried in Montgomery Cemetery, later McEntire Cemetery which is south of the old home place in Murray County, GA.

Info from I.E. Wallen "The Hames Chronicles"
Born on 6 May 1823, in Murray County, GA, Rebecca was the daughter of Hiram Montgomery and Milcha Cavender.  Rebecca married William Sanford Hames in 1849 and had 7 children.  Her sister Elizabeth married Joseph Hames, and her cousin James Riley (son of Thomas Montgomery) and his sister Martha Montgomery married a daughter and son of Thomas Henry Hames.  Hames and Montgomerys were close in Murray County, GA, and also in Izard County, AR. She is supposed to have come from Georgia to Missouri and thence to Arkansas.  She visited Georgia to see her brothers, George and Bill, after coming to Arkansas.  Rebecca belonged to the MEthodist Chruch.  Whenever ladies would come to see her, she always had a quilt in the frames and they would visit while quilting.  She dies on 3 Nov 1896 and was buried in the Wideman Cemetery along side of her daughter, Meeka.

Hiram Montgomery - Milchia Ann "Milky" Cavender

Hiram Montgomery was born at South Carolina 16 Jul 1796. His parents were William M. Montgomery and Ailsey or Elsie Crittenden.

He married Milchia Ann "Milky" Cavender 23 Jan 1819 at Hall, Georgia . Milchia Ann "Milky" Cavender was born at Hall, Georgia 6 Feb 1802 daughter of Clemeth Cavender and Rebecca Rachel Dedman .

They were the parents of 12 children:
William Montgomery born 28 Nov 1819.
Thomas Montgomery born 11 Jun 1821.
Rebecca Montgomery born 6 May 1823.
Alsie Montgomery born 24 Aug 1824.
Elizabeth Montgomery born 11 Aug 1827.
Meekey Montgomery born 5 Jan 1830.
Samuel Montgomery born 1 Jan 1832.
King Montgomery born 9 Apr 1834.
John Montgomery born 5 Aug 1836.
Sarah Josephine Montgomery born 23 Dec 1838.
George W. Montgomery born 11 Feb 1841.
Mahala Montgomery born 15 Apr 1844.

Hiram Montgomery died 10 Dec 1867 at Murry, Georgia .

Milchia Ann "Milky" Cavender died 12 Jan 1888 at Murry, Georgia .
